Western Iowa Tech Community College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

During the 2022-2023 academic year, part-time undergraduate students at Western Iowa Tech Community College paid an average of $179 per credit hour if they came to the school from out-of-state. In-state students paid a discounted rate of $173 per credit hour. The following table shows the average full-time tuition and fees for undergraduates.

In State Out of State
Tuition $4,152 $4,296
Fees $890 $890
Books and Supplies $1,200 $1,200
On Campus Room and Board $6,291 $6,291
On Campus Other Expenses $4,935 $4,935
